whistling coming from rear
 
whats up, just got my second 240 and couldn't be happier. it's a 92 hatch with stock KA and tranny. heres the deal, it runs really strong up until mid range rpms (will get exact rpm when i have time) where it seems to lose power (nothing too bad just noticable). there is a really loud annoying whistle coming from what sounds like either the drive shaft rubbing something or my rear diff. my roomate has a 90 240 hatch sr20det and he said it sounds like the tranny whinning. got the rear diff and tranny drained and relubed today and it's still whisling. and still grinding going into second pretty bad. im going to bleed the clutch today and see if that helps the grinding going into second, the guy i bought it from replaced the master cylinder and i don't think he bled the clutch thouroughly enough. anyone had this whisling before or have any ideas as to what it is? it only whistles when the clutch is out and im on the gas, through all gears (worst in 4 and 5). when i let off the gas to a coast or just engage the clutch the whisling goes away? sounds like a tranny to me just wondering if anyone has any alternative ideas.

i got the tranny and rear diff flushed and filled back up. the gear oil in the diff looked absolutely horrible. just found out through a friend of the guy i bought the car from that the stock diff is welded and i'm pretty sure they did a poor job. as for the mid range loss, it isn't the typical s13 weak mid range, it actually stutters after shifting everyonce in a while, esspecially when the accelerator is steady. (thought it may be the fuel pump but have since exhausted the possiblilty) i've run down all the options and come to the conclusion that it's the poorly welded spider gears so i'm getting an oem rear diff and getting it welded properly to hopefully aleiviate the whistling. it's got a good start as a drifter just need to fix some minor things. i'll get some pics up as soon as i can and let you guys check it out. thanks for the help and i'll talk to you guys later. :thumb:
